Nicholas Arthur THOMPSON 1882–1935 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 13 DEC 1882
Birth Location: Wahalla Vic.
Death Date: 3 DEC 1935
Death Location: Brunswick Vic.
Father: John THOMPSON
Mother: Jane HANGAN
Spouse(s): Emma TRELEAVAN
Children(s): Dorothy THOMPSON, William THOMPSON, Leonard THOMPSON
In 1882, Nicholas Arthur THOMPSON entered the world in Wahalla Vic., born to John William Thompson And Jane Hangan. Nicholas Arthur THOMPSON married Emma Treleavan, and had children including Dorothy Myrtle Thompson, Elva Thompson, Leonard Arthur Thompson, William Nicholas Thompson. Nicholas Arthur THOMPSON passed away in 1935 in Brunswick Vic..
